His shows on 1960s-'70s WNIB in Chicago were heard by few. The station was "the other" classical music station on FM then. Dick Lawrence shows made up as filler, to save the family owned minuscule budget another evening host on Saturdays. The shows were quirky and I didn't always luv the subjects, but I stuck with it. Now I know how precious they were as audio tales of life in the 1920s mostly. It is golden, I truly wish we could thank Mr. L. for his dedication to his craft and passion!
